# Graph Layout Scaling Implementation Plan
> **For agentic workers:** REQUIRED SUB-SKILL: Use superpowers:subagent-driven-development (recommended) or superpowers:executing-plans to implement this plan task-by-task. Steps use checkbox (`- [ ]`) syntax for tracking.
**Goal:** Replace dagre with ELK across structural-style dashboard views, add folder/community-based containers in the layer-detail view, and compute layout in two lazy stages so layers with many nodes are readable and large graphs stay performant.
**Architecture:** Three views (overview, DomainGraphView, layer-detail) call a new `applyElkLayout` instead of `applyDagreLayout`. The layer-detail view gains a `deriveContainers` step (folder strategy with Louvain fallback), aggregated cross-container edges, lazy two-stage ELK calls (Stage 1 = containers; Stage 2 = a container's children on demand), a new `ContainerNode` React Flow node type, and store extensions for expand state and layout caches.
**Tech Stack:** TypeScript, React 19, Vite, React Flow (`@xyflow/react`), Zustand, Vitest, ELK.js (`elkjs`), `graphology` + `graphology-communities-louvain`.
**Spec:** `docs/superpowers/specs/2026-05-03-graph-layout-scaling-design.md`

## Task 2: deriveContainers — folder strategy + edge cases
**Files:**
- Create: `understand-anything-plugin/packages/dashboard/src/utils/containers.ts`
- Create: `understand-anything-plugin/packages/dashboard/src/utils/__tests__/containers.test.ts`
- [ ] **Step 1: Write failing tests**
Create `understand-anything-plugin/packages/dashboard/src/utils/__tests__/containers.test.ts`:
```ts
import { describe, it, expect } from "vitest";
import { deriveContainers } from "../containers";
import type { GraphNode, GraphEdge } from "@understand-anything/core/types";
function node(id: string, filePath?: string): GraphNode {
return {
id,
type: "file",
name: id,
filePath,
summary: "",
complexity: "simple",
} as GraphNode;
}
describe("deriveContainers — folder strategy", () => {
it("groups nodes by first folder segment after LCP", () => {
const nodes = [
node("a", "src/auth/login.go"),
node("b", "src/auth/oauth.go"),
node("c", "src/cart/cart.go"),
node("d", "src/cart/checkout.go"),
];
const { containers, ungrouped } = deriveContainers(nodes, []);
expect(ungrouped).toEqual([]);
expect(containers).toHaveLength(2);
const names = containers.map((c) => c.name).sort();
expect(names).toEqual(["auth", "cart"]);
const auth = containers.find((c) => c.name === "auth")!;
expect(auth.strategy).toBe("folder");
expect(auth.nodeIds.sort()).toEqual(["a", "b"]);
});
it("strips deep LCP", () => {
const nodes = [
node("a", "monorepo/backend/src/auth/login.go"),
node("b", "monorepo/backend/src/cart/cart.go"),
];
const { containers } = deriveContainers(nodes, []);
const names = containers.map((c) => c.name).sort();
expect(names).toEqual(["auth", "cart"]);
});
it("collapses nested folders into the first segment", () => {
const nodes = [
node("a", "auth/handlers/oauth.go"),
node("b", "auth/services/token.go"),
node("c", "cart/cart.go"),
];
const { containers } = deriveContainers(nodes, []);
expect(containers.find((c) => c.name === "auth")?.nodeIds.sort()).toEqual(["a", "b"]);
});
it("places nodes without filePath in '~' container", () => {
const nodes = [
node("a", "auth/login.go"),
node("b", "auth/oauth.go"),
node("c"),
node("d"),
];
const { containers } = deriveContainers(nodes, []);
expect(containers.find((c) => c.name === "~")?.nodeIds.sort()).toEqual(["c", "d"]);
});
it("suppresses single-child containers (single child becomes ungrouped)", () => {
const nodes = [
node("a", "auth/login.go"),
node("b", "auth/oauth.go"),
node("c", "cart/cart.go"),
];
const { containers, ungrouped } = deriveContainers(nodes, []);
// 'cart' has only 1 child → suppressed
expect(containers.find((c) => c.name === "cart")).toBeUndefined();
expect(ungrouped).toContain("c");
// 'auth' kept
expect(containers.find((c) => c.name === "auth")?.nodeIds.sort()).toEqual(["a", "b"]);
});
it("returns flat (no containers) when total nodes < 8", () => {
const nodes = [
node("a", "auth/x.go"),
node("b", "cart/y.go"),
node("c", "logs/z.go"),
];
const { containers, ungrouped } = deriveContainers(nodes, []);
expect(containers).toHaveLength(0);
expect(ungrouped.sort()).toEqual(["a", "b", "c"]);
});
});
```
- [ ] **Step 2: Run tests to verify they fail**
```bash
pnpm --filter @understand-anything/dashboard test containers
```
Expected: import error — `Cannot find module '../containers'`.
- [ ] **Step 3: Implement `containers.ts`**
Create `understand-anything-plugin/packages/dashboard/src/utils/containers.ts`:
```ts
import type {
GraphNode,
GraphEdge,
} from "@understand-anything/core/types";
import { detectCommunities } from "./louvain";
export interface DerivedContainer {
id: string;
name: string;
nodeIds: string[];
strategy: "folder" | "community";
}
export interface DeriveResult {
containers: DerivedContainer[];
ungrouped: string[];
}
const MIN_LAYER_SIZE_FOR_GROUPING = 8;
const MIN_FOLDER_COUNT = 3;
const MAX_CONCENTRATION = 0.6;
const ROOT_BUCKET = "~";
function commonPrefix(paths: string[]): string {
if (paths.length === 0) return "";
let prefix = paths[0];
for (const p of paths) {
while (!p.startsWith(prefix)) {
prefix = prefix.slice(0, -1);
if (!prefix) return "";
}
}
// Trim back to a directory boundary
const lastSlash = prefix.lastIndexOf("/");
return lastSlash >= 0 ? prefix.slice(0, lastSlash + 1) : "";
}
function firstSegment(path: string): string {
const slash = path.indexOf("/");
return slash >= 0 ? path.slice(0, slash) : path;
}
function groupByFolder(
nodes: GraphNode[],
): { groups: Map<string, string[]>; rooted: string[] } {
const withPath = nodes.filter((n) => n.filePath);
const lcp = commonPrefix(withPath.map((n) => n.filePath!));
const groups = new Map<string, string[]>();
const rooted: string[] = [];
for (const n of withPath) {
const stripped = n.filePath!.slice(lcp.length);
if (!stripped.includes("/")) {
rooted.push(n.id);
continue;
}
const seg = firstSegment(stripped);
const arr = groups.get(seg) ?? [];
arr.push(n.id);
groups.set(seg, arr);
}
for (const n of nodes) {
if (!n.filePath) rooted.push(n.id);
}
return { groups, rooted };
}
function shouldFallbackToCommunity(
groups: Map<string, string[]>,
totalNodes: number,
): boolean {
if (groups.size < MIN_FOLDER_COUNT) return true;
for (const ids of groups.values()) {
if (ids.length / totalNodes > MAX_CONCENTRATION) return true;
}
return false;
}
export function deriveContainers(
nodes: GraphNode[],
edges: GraphEdge[],
): DeriveResult {
if (nodes.length < MIN_LAYER_SIZE_FOR_GROUPING) {
return { containers: [], ungrouped: nodes.map((n) => n.id) };
}
const { groups, rooted } = groupByFolder(nodes);
const useCommunity = shouldFallbackToCommunity(groups, nodes.length);
let containers: DerivedContainer[];
if (useCommunity) {
const communities = detectCommunities(
nodes.map((n) => n.id),
edges,
);
const byCommunity = new Map<number, string[]>();
for (const [nodeId, cid] of communities) {
const arr = byCommunity.get(cid) ?? [];
arr.push(nodeId);
byCommunity.set(cid, arr);
}
const sorted = [...byCommunity.entries()].sort((a, b) => a[0] - b[0]);
containers = sorted.map(([cid, ids], i) => ({
id: `container:cluster-${cid}`,
name: `Cluster ${String.fromCharCode(65 + i)}`,
nodeIds: ids,
strategy: "community" as const,
}));
} else {
containers = [...groups.entries()].map(([seg, ids]) => ({
id: `container:${seg}`,
name: seg,
nodeIds: ids,
strategy: "folder" as const,
}));
if (rooted.length > 0) {
containers.push({
id: `container:${ROOT_BUCKET}`,
name: ROOT_BUCKET,
nodeIds: rooted,
strategy: "folder" as const,
});
}
}
// Suppress single-child containers
const ungrouped: string[] = [];
containers = containers.filter((c) => {
if (c.nodeIds.length === 1) {
ungrouped.push(c.nodeIds[0]);
return false;
}
return true;
});
return { containers, ungrouped };
}
```

## Task 3: deriveContainers — community fallback (Louvain)
**Files:**
- Modify: `understand-anything-plugin/packages/dashboard/src/utils/louvain.ts`
- Modify: `understand-anything-plugin/packages/dashboard/src/utils/__tests__/containers.test.ts`
- [ ] **Step 1: Add failing test for community fallback**
Append to `containers.test.ts`:
```ts
describe("deriveContainers — community fallback", () => {
it("falls back to communities when only one folder present", () => {
const nodes = Array.from({ length: 10 }, (_, i) =>
node(`n${i}`, `services/n${i}.go`),
);
// Two clusters of 5 nodes; densely connected within, no edges between
const edges: GraphEdge[] = [];
for (const i of [0, 1, 2, 3, 4]) {
for (const j of [0, 1, 2, 3, 4]) {
if (i !== j) edges.push({ source: `n${i}`, target: `n${j}`, type: "calls" } as GraphEdge);
}
}
for (const i of [5, 6, 7, 8, 9]) {
for (const j of [5, 6, 7, 8, 9]) {
if (i !== j) edges.push({ source: `n${i}`, target: `n${j}`, type: "calls" } as GraphEdge);
}
}
const { containers } = deriveContainers(nodes, edges);
expect(containers.length).toBeGreaterThanOrEqual(2);
for (const c of containers) {
expect(c.strategy).toBe("community");
expect(c.name).toMatch(/^Cluster [A-Z]$/);
}
});
it("falls back when one folder holds > 60%", () => {
const nodes = [
...Array.from({ length: 8 }, (_, i) => node(`big${i}`, `big/file${i}.go`)),
node("a", "small1/a.go"),
node("b", "small2/b.go"),
];
const { containers } = deriveContainers(nodes, []);
expect(containers.every((c) => c.strategy === "community")).toBe(true);
});
});
```
- [ ] **Step 2: Run tests, expect failure**
```bash
pnpm --filter @understand-anything/dashboard test containers
```
Expected: the new tests fail because the louvain stub puts every node in community 0 (only 1 container after suppression).
- [ ] **Step 3: Replace louvain stub with real implementation**
Overwrite `understand-anything-plugin/packages/dashboard/src/utils/louvain.ts`:
```ts
import Graph from "graphology";
import louvain from "graphology-communities-louvain";
import type { GraphEdge } from "@understand-anything/core/types";
/**
* Run Louvain community detection over the provided node set and the
* subset of edges whose endpoints are both in the set. Returns a map of
* nodeId → communityId. Disconnected nodes get unique community ids so
* they don't collapse into a single cluster.
*/
export function detectCommunities(
nodeIds: string[],
edges: GraphEdge[],
): Map<string, number> {
const ids = new Set(nodeIds);
const g = new Graph({ type: "undirected", multi: false });
for (const id of nodeIds) g.addNode(id);
for (const e of edges) {
if (!ids.has(e.source) || !ids.has(e.target)) continue;
if (e.source === e.target) continue;
if (g.hasEdge(e.source, e.target)) continue;
g.addEdge(e.source, e.target);
}
// graphology-communities-louvain returns Record<nodeId, communityId>
const result = louvain(g) as Record<string, number>;
const map = new Map<string, number>();
for (const id of nodeIds) {
map.set(id, result[id] ?? -1);
}
// Reassign disconnected nodes (community -1) to unique ids past the max
let next =
Math.max(...Array.from(map.values()).filter((v) => v >= 0), -1) + 1;
for (const [id, c] of map) {
if (c === -1) {
map.set(id, next++);
}
}
return map;
}
```

## Task 4: aggregateContainerEdges
**Files:**
- Modify: `understand-anything-plugin/packages/dashboard/src/utils/edgeAggregation.ts`
- Create: `understand-anything-plugin/packages/dashboard/src/utils/__tests__/edgeAggregation.test.ts`
- [ ] **Step 1: Write failing tests**
Create `understand-anything-plugin/packages/dashboard/src/utils/__tests__/edgeAggregation.test.ts`:
```ts
import { describe, it, expect } from "vitest";
import { aggregateContainerEdges } from "../edgeAggregation";
import type { GraphEdge } from "@understand-anything/core/types";
const ce = (source: string, target: string, type: string = "calls"): GraphEdge =>
({ source, target, type }) as GraphEdge;
describe("aggregateContainerEdges", () => {
it("returns empty arrays for empty input", () => {
const r = aggregateContainerEdges([], new Map());
expect(r.intraContainer).toEqual([]);
expect(r.interContainerAggregated).toEqual([]);
});
it("preserves intra-container edges as-is", () => {
const m = new Map([
["a", "auth"],
["b", "auth"],
]);
const r = aggregateContainerEdges([ce("a", "b")], m);
expect(r.intraContainer).toHaveLength(1);
expect(r.interContainerAggregated).toEqual([]);
});
it("merges multiple same-direction inter edges into one", () => {
const m = new Map([
["a", "auth"],
["b", "auth"],
["c", "cart"],
["d", "cart"],
]);
const edges = [ce("a", "c"), ce("a", "d"), ce("b", "c", "imports")];
const r = aggregateContainerEdges(edges, m);
expect(r.interContainerAggregated).toHaveLength(1);
const agg = r.interContainerAggregated[0];
expect(agg.sourceContainerId).toBe("auth");
expect(agg.targetContainerId).toBe("cart");
expect(agg.count).toBe(3);
expect(agg.types.sort()).toEqual(["calls", "imports"]);
});
it("treats opposite directions as separate aggregated edges", () => {
const m = new Map([
["a", "auth"],
["c", "cart"],
]);
const r = aggregateContainerEdges([ce("a", "c"), ce("c", "a")], m);
expect(r.interContainerAggregated).toHaveLength(2);
const dirs = r.interContainerAggregated.map(
(e) => `${e.sourceContainerId}${e.targetContainerId}`,
);
expect(dirs.sort()).toEqual(["auth→cart", "cart→auth"]);
});
it("ignores edges whose endpoints have no container mapping", () => {
const m = new Map([["a", "auth"]]);
const r = aggregateContainerEdges([ce("a", "z")], m);
expect(r.intraContainer).toEqual([]);
expect(r.interContainerAggregated).toEqual([]);
});
});
```
- [ ] **Step 2: Run tests, expect failure**
```bash
pnpm --filter @understand-anything/dashboard test edgeAggregation
```
Expected: import error — `aggregateContainerEdges` not exported.
- [ ] **Step 3: Implement**
Append to `understand-anything-plugin/packages/dashboard/src/utils/edgeAggregation.ts`:
```ts
import type { GraphEdge } from "@understand-anything/core/types";
export interface AggregatedContainerEdge {
sourceContainerId: string;
targetContainerId: string;
count: number;
types: string[];
}
export interface ContainerEdgeBuckets {
intraContainer: GraphEdge[];
interContainerAggregated: AggregatedContainerEdge[];
}
/**
* Bucket edges into intra-container (preserved) and inter-container
* (aggregated by directed (source,target) container pair).
*
* Direction is significant: A→B and B→A produce two independent
* aggregated edges. Edges whose endpoints have no container mapping
* are dropped (treat them as pre-filtered).
*/
export function aggregateContainerEdges(
edges: GraphEdge[],
nodeToContainer: Map<string, string>,
): ContainerEdgeBuckets {
const intra: GraphEdge[] = [];
const interMap = new Map<
string,
{
sourceContainerId: string;
targetContainerId: string;
count: number;
types: Set<string>;
}
>();
for (const e of edges) {
const sc = nodeToContainer.get(e.source);
const tc = nodeToContainer.get(e.target);
if (!sc || !tc) continue;
if (sc === tc) {
intra.push(e);
continue;
}
const key = `${sc}${tc}`;
const existing = interMap.get(key);
if (existing) {
existing.count++;
existing.types.add(e.type);
} else {
interMap.set(key, {
sourceContainerId: sc,
targetContainerId: tc,
count: 1,
types: new Set([e.type]),
});
}
}
const interContainerAggregated: AggregatedContainerEdge[] = [...interMap.values()].map(
(v) => ({
sourceContainerId: v.sourceContainerId,
targetContainerId: v.targetContainerId,
count: v.count,
types: [...v.types],
}),
);
return { intraContainer: intra, interContainerAggregated };
}
```

## Task 5: ELK input repair
**Files:**
- Create: `understand-anything-plugin/packages/dashboard/src/utils/elk-layout.ts`
- Create: `understand-anything-plugin/packages/dashboard/src/utils/__tests__/elk-layout.test.ts`
- [ ] **Step 1: Write failing tests for repair functions**
Create `understand-anything-plugin/packages/dashboard/src/utils/__tests__/elk-layout.test.ts`:
```ts
import { describe, it, expect } from "vitest";
import { repairElkInput, type ElkInput } from "../elk-layout";
describe("repairElkInput", () => {
it("ensures node dimensions when missing", () => {
const input: ElkInput = {
id: "root",
children: [{ id: "a" }, { id: "b", width: 100, height: 50 }] as ElkInput["children"],
edges: [],
};
const { input: out, issues } = repairElkInput(input);
expect(out.children![0].width).toBeGreaterThan(0);
expect(out.children![0].height).toBeGreaterThan(0);
expect(out.children![1]).toEqual({ id: "b", width: 100, height: 50 });
expect(issues.some((i) => i.level === "auto-corrected" && /dimensions/.test(i.message))).toBe(true);
});
it("dedupes duplicate child ids and reports auto-corrected", () => {
const input: ElkInput = {
id: "root",
children: [
{ id: "a", width: 1, height: 1 },
{ id: "a", width: 1, height: 1 },
],
edges: [],
};
const { input: out, issues } = repairElkInput(input);
expect(out.children).toHaveLength(1);
expect(issues.some((i) => i.level === "auto-corrected" && /duplicate/.test(i.message))).toBe(true);
});
it("drops orphan edges referencing nonexistent nodes", () => {
const input: ElkInput = {
id: "root",
children: [{ id: "a", width: 1, height: 1 }],
edges: [
{ id: "e1", sources: ["a"], targets: ["ghost"] },
],
};
const { input: out, issues } = repairElkInput(input);
expect(out.edges).toHaveLength(0);
expect(issues.some((i) => i.level === "dropped" && /edge/.test(i.message))).toBe(true);
});
it("drops children referencing nonexistent parents", () => {
const input: ElkInput = {
id: "root",
children: [
{
id: "p",
width: 100,
height: 100,
children: [{ id: "c1", width: 1, height: 1 }],
},
{ id: "orphan", width: 1, height: 1, parentId: "ghost" } as ElkInput["children"][0] & { parentId: string },
],
edges: [],
};
const { input: out, issues } = repairElkInput(input);
expect(out.children!.find((c) => c.id === "orphan")).toBeUndefined();
expect(issues.some((i) => i.level === "dropped" && /parent/.test(i.message))).toBe(true);
});
it("strict mode throws on any issue", () => {
const input: ElkInput = {
id: "root",
children: [{ id: "a" }] as ElkInput["children"],
edges: [],
};
expect(() => repairElkInput(input, { strict: true })).toThrow(/dimensions/);
});
});
```
- [ ] **Step 2: Run tests, expect failure**
```bash
pnpm --filter @understand-anything/dashboard test elk-layout
```
Expected: import error — `../elk-layout` not found.
- [ ] **Step 3: Implement repairElkInput**
Create `understand-anything-plugin/packages/dashboard/src/utils/elk-layout.ts`:
```ts
import ELK from "elkjs/lib/elk.bundled.js";
import type { GraphIssue } from "@understand-anything/core/schema";
export interface ElkChild {
id: string;
width?: number;
height?: number;
children?: ElkChild[];
parentId?: string;
}
export interface ElkEdge {
id: string;
sources: string[];
targets: string[];
}
export interface ElkInput {
id: string;
children: ElkChild[];
edges: ElkEdge[];
layoutOptions?: Record<string, string>;
}
const DEFAULT_NODE_WIDTH = 280;
const DEFAULT_NODE_HEIGHT = 120;
interface RepairOptions {
strict?: boolean;
}
interface RepairResult {
input: ElkInput;
issues: GraphIssue[];
}
function makeIssue(level: GraphIssue["level"], message: string): GraphIssue {
return { level, message };
}
function maybeThrow(strict: boolean | undefined, issue: GraphIssue): void {
if (strict) throw new Error(`[ELK repair] ${issue.level}: ${issue.message}`);
}
export function repairElkInput(
input: ElkInput,
opts: RepairOptions = {},
): RepairResult {
const issues: GraphIssue[] = [];
const strict = opts.strict;
// 1. ensureNodeDimensions
let dimsAdded = 0;
const fillDims = (children: ElkChild[]): ElkChild[] =>
children.map((c) => {
const next: ElkChild = { ...c };
if (next.width == null || next.height == null) {
next.width = next.width ?? DEFAULT_NODE_WIDTH;
next.height = next.height ?? DEFAULT_NODE_HEIGHT;
dimsAdded++;
}
if (next.children) next.children = fillDims(next.children);
return next;
});
const childrenA = fillDims(input.children);
if (dimsAdded > 0) {
const issue = makeIssue(
"auto-corrected",
`Set default dimensions on ${dimsAdded} node(s) missing width/height.`,
);
issues.push(issue);
maybeThrow(strict, issue);
}
// 2. dedupeNodeIds (per parent)
let dupesRemoved = 0;
const dedupe = (children: ElkChild[]): ElkChild[] => {
const seen = new Set<string>();
const out: ElkChild[] = [];
for (const c of children) {
if (seen.has(c.id)) {
dupesRemoved++;
continue;
}
seen.add(c.id);
out.push({
...c,
children: c.children ? dedupe(c.children) : undefined,
});
}
return out;
};
const childrenB = dedupe(childrenA);
if (dupesRemoved > 0) {
const issue = makeIssue(
"auto-corrected",
`Removed ${dupesRemoved} duplicate child id(s).`,
);
issues.push(issue);
maybeThrow(strict, issue);
}
// 3. dropOrphanChildren — children whose parentId references nonexistent parent
// (Only top-level children are checked; ELK uses nesting, not parentId, but
// upstream code may use parentId hints.)
const allIds = new Set<string>();
const walk = (children: ElkChild[]) => {
for (const c of children) {
allIds.add(c.id);
if (c.children) walk(c.children);
}
};
walk(childrenB);
let orphanChildren = 0;
const childrenC = childrenB.filter((c) => {
if (c.parentId && !allIds.has(c.parentId)) {
orphanChildren++;
return false;
}
return true;
});
if (orphanChildren > 0) {
const issue = makeIssue(
"dropped",
`Dropped ${orphanChildren} child(ren) with missing parent reference.`,
);
issues.push(issue);
maybeThrow(strict, issue);
}
// 4. dropOrphanEdges
let orphanEdges = 0;
const edges = input.edges.filter((e) => {
const ok = e.sources.every((s) => allIds.has(s)) &&
e.targets.every((t) => allIds.has(t));
if (!ok) {
orphanEdges++;
return false;
}
return true;
});
if (orphanEdges > 0) {
const issue = makeIssue(
"dropped",
`Dropped ${orphanEdges} edge(s) referencing nonexistent nodes.`,
);
issues.push(issue);
maybeThrow(strict, issue);
}
// 5. dropCircularContainment
// Build parent map by walking nesting
const parentOf = new Map<string, string>();
const fillParents = (children: ElkChild[], parent?: string) => {
for (const c of children) {
if (parent) parentOf.set(c.id, parent);
if (c.children) fillParents(c.children, c.id);
}
};
fillParents(childrenC);
let cyclesRemoved = 0;
const isCyclic = (id: string): boolean => {
const seen = new Set<string>();
let cur = parentOf.get(id);
while (cur) {
if (cur === id || seen.has(cur)) return true;
seen.add(cur);
cur = parentOf.get(cur);
}
return false;
};
const stripCycles = (children: ElkChild[]): ElkChild[] =>
children
.filter((c) => {
if (isCyclic(c.id)) {
cyclesRemoved++;
return false;
}
return true;
})
.map((c) => ({
...c,
children: c.children ? stripCycles(c.children) : undefined,
}));
const childrenD = stripCycles(childrenC);
if (cyclesRemoved > 0) {
const issue = makeIssue(
"dropped",
`Dropped ${cyclesRemoved} node(s) in containment cycles.`,
);
issues.push(issue);
maybeThrow(strict, issue);
}
return {
input: { ...input, children: childrenD, edges },
issues,
};
}
const elk = new ELK();
export interface ElkLayoutOptions {
strict?: boolean;
}
export interface ElkLayoutResult {
positioned: ElkInput;
issues: GraphIssue[];
}
export async function applyElkLayout(
input: ElkInput,
opts: ElkLayoutOptions = {},
): Promise<ElkLayoutResult> {
const { input: repaired, issues } = repairElkInput(input, opts);
try {
const positioned = (await elk.layout(repaired as never)) as ElkInput;
return { positioned, issues };
} catch (err) {
const fatal: GraphIssue = {
level: "fatal",
message:
`ELK layout failed: ${err instanceof Error ? err.message : String(err)}. ` +
`This looks like a dashboard rendering bug — please file an issue with the copied error.`,
};
if (opts.strict) throw err;
return { positioned: { ...repaired, children: [], edges: [] }, issues: [...issues, fatal] };
}
}
```
